Cycling routes in Prov. West-Vlaanderen
Historic towns and iconic cobbled roads.
Prov. West-Vlaanderen, Belgium is a cyclist's paradise with its well-developed network of cycling routes and flat terrain. The region offers a mix of historic towns, beautiful countryside, and scenic coastal routes. Cyclists can explore the famous cobbled roads of Flanders and visit iconic cycling destinations like Bruges. Notable cycling spots in Prov. West-Vlaanderen include the Kemmelberg, a challenging climb located in the Heuvelland region, and the Zeeland Flanders, a coastal area with scenic bike paths. With its cycling-friendly infrastructure and rich cycling history, Prov. West-Vlaanderen is a top destination for road and gravel cyclists.
